Unitree Go2 W Ent-U5 (With Controller)
The Unitree Go2 W Ent-U5 is a cutting-edge quadruped robot designed for enterprise, industrial, and professional applications. Equipped with a dedicated controller, it provides precise control, autonomous capabilities, and advanced mobility for inspection, monitoring, and research tasks.
Built to perform reliably in complex environments, the Go2 W Ent-U5 combines agile movement, intelligent sensing, and a robust frame to meet the demanding needs of professional teams. It is ideal for field operations, automation experiments, and real-world deployments.

Extended Battery Life
-
Up to 2 hours of continuous operation under standard conditions.
-
Optimized for prolonged fieldwork, industrial tasks, and research projects.
